Subject: Handover — GarageSense occupancy feed

Hey team,

Taking over release duty from Priya this week. Quick notes on the GarageSense occupancy feed for the Velmont Plaza garages: the v2.3 push went out clean, but the sensor aggregator still hiccups around midnight rollover, so expect the odd stale-count ticket. Workaround is in the support wiki. If you need to re-sign the feed bundle for a hotfix, use the current deploy key, pasted below for convenience.

rollout seal: bky19_M1Zvn1YQwEBTy4XxP3H

Ticket OPS-881: The read-replica lag alarm for the Tarnbrook cluster stopped firing on the 3rd. Root cause: the credential the alarm agent uses to query the Pindle metrics API expired, and failures were silently swallowed. We added error alerting on auth failures and issued a replacement key with identical read-only scope. For the security review: old key is revoked, rotation is now calendared quarterly. The replacement key provisioned for the Pindle metrics API is below.

service key, bajog-yahop: kto7_mMHVCpJ

Hi all,

Quick heads-up from the front desk: we've set up a guest Wi-Fi desk at reception so visitors stop wandering around looking for someone with a login. If you're hosting a guest at Bramleigh House, just point them our way and we'll sort their connection voucher in about two minutes. The desk runs 8:30 to 17:00, Monday to Friday. If you need to open the voucher drawer yourselves outside those hours, use the pass code below.

Thanks,
Front Desk Team

door code, yagap-bahof: bdg-O-05

## Authentication

The Gridwhim crossword generator exposes its puzzle-rendering endpoints behind the internal Lattercote auth gateway. All requests must carry a bearer token; unauthenticated calls return 401 and are logged to the on-call channel. Tokens are long-lived service keys, rotated quarterly by the platform team. If generation jobs start failing with auth errors during your shift, verify the key has not been rotated out from under the worker pool. The current service key for the staging worker is provided below.

API key for yahig-tadup: kto7_ubizbYm